Description
A FromSoftware action RPG released in 2003, the third entry in the Shadow Tower franchise. A first-person dungeon crawler in the King's Field tradition. The hero descends into a giant tower infested with creatures to recover captive souls. Real-time melee combat, exhausting exploration and oppressive atmosphere. A FromSoftware cult niche before Souls.

Collector interest
A spiritual successor to From Software's King's Field, Shadow Tower Abyss is a first-person dungeon crawler exclusive to Japan, never translated or exported. A direct precursor to the DNA that would lead to Demon's Souls, it holds cult status among fans of pre-Souls From. Its value rests on territorial exclusivity and retrospective interest in the studio's roots far more than on print numbers. Sought by From Software completists.
Is Shadow Tower Abyss still worth playing in 2026?
An action RPG from FromSoftware, Shadow Tower Abyss extends the King's Field tradition with a first person dungeon crawler where you descend a giant tower infested with creatures, carefully managing weapons, ammo and durability. The oppressive atmosphere, the solitude and the merciless difficulty foreshadow the DNA of the studio's future Souls games. The old school stiffness and the Japan exclusivity call for commitment. A choice piece for fans of demanding crawlers and of FromSoftware's roots.
